摘要
This paper presents a review of existing studies on the microstructure and thermal conductivity of cement-based foam. Previous studies on constituent materials, measurement techniques for thermal properties, characterization of microstructure, the thermal conductivity of cement-based foam and conductivity models for the dry porous material are included in the discussion. Based on the review, the following research areas have been identified: (i) Influence of pozzolanic admixtures and different cast densities on the thermal conductivity of cement-based foam (ii) Effect of microstructure on the thermal conductivity (iii) Governing hydrated products and their impact on the conductivity of cement-based foam.
